Lead Generation and Tracking

A website can be used specifically as a lead generation tool. Usually, the most effective way to achieve this is to focus the website on one conversion and keep it simple. The whole site must be built around the attempt to get the right person to do something specific (fill out a form, usually). Not…

Jason Broadwater named Chair of Leadership Commitee RHEDC

Jason Broadwater, RevenAgent and President of RevenFlo, is named Chair of the Leadership Committee of the Rock Hill Economic Development Corporation. The Leadership Committee is responsible for setting the comprehensive economic development strategy and agenda for the city of Rock Hill, SC, as approved and adopted by City Council.
